Failure to furnish required statistics attracts fines and daily continuing-offence penalties subject to a statutory cap. Failure to furnish required information or return, without reasonable cause, or wilful furnishing of information known to be false, is punishable by a fine; a continuing offence attracts an additional daily fine for each day after the first day during which the offence continues, subject to a maximum cumulative cap.
